SIMON AZINGARE (2015 GRADUATE)
I have been Leading from my head and after the training I received from WWTC, am now Leading from my heart. I had passion without knowledge. I thank God for WWTC. The Courses that transformed my life most are: Motivation Gifts, the Holy Spirit, Concepts of Leadership, Ministry Gifts , Faith Concepts and Evangelism. My perspective has changed, no matter what happens I know God is working out something good in every challenge. WWTC prepared me for the new journey of Christian leadership that I didn’t know. I have been chosen to be the Christian Union Pastor of Nairobi University, Main Campus for the First Years’. I bless God for everyone who gave their money to support us while at school. WWTC is an emblem of Love.

MOSES KACHINA (2015 GRADUATE)
I didn’t know what it entailed when I joined WWTC , it seemed that I was in the wrong place but after the first Courses the Holy Spirit illuminated my spirit hence I began to see the purpose why I was at school despite the challenges I was going through. It was hard for me but the grace of God sustained me. The love from WWTC Staff and the Founders motivated me despite the hardship that was affecting me. I had been in ministry for long time but it seemed like during that time I was asleep because I was just doing Ministry as a routine, but I thank God now I Minister and lead people from my heart not the head as I used to do. The teachings changed me, am anew person, a leader with a vision to conquer the World for Christ. I know God loves me and He wants the Best for me. God shall never leave me nor forsake me. Christ in me, enables me to withstand every challenge and now I see people in the mirror of love not legalistic as I used to do.
TESTIMONY FROM BISHOP CHARLES MURANJE (MOSES’ PASTOR)
Pst. Moses is such a great Minister, teaching the Word of God with a deep revelation. He is so obedient and an example. Members of the Church enjoy him Ministering God’s Love. It’s a great benefit to the Church and I thank God that Moses joined WWTC. I encouraged every Pastor to send their Leaders to WWTC and their lives shall never be the same again.

ACHIEVEMENTS
This year we had 17 Graduates and three Alumni graduated with Associate Degrees from Abba Bible Academy, USA. We had great life transforming Missions in Transmara, Turkana and other parts of the Country. Also in August we had Continuing Education Seminar. Nicholas Lilumbi (WWTC2010 Graduate) got married in August this year.
